A regular, over-the-counter contract iPhone in France will be sold to you locked to the carrier. However, due to French law, it is mandatory to offer an authorized system to unlock the phone upon request.

Within the first 6 months of ownership, it will cost you extra to unlock a phone in France. After the first 6 months are up, you can have the phone unlocked for free.

But if you entered into a fixed-term contract, you'd still be bound by the rest of the terms of the contract even after having your phone unlocked.

Both Tim and Vodafone will sell it unlocked from June 19th. Similar prices as for the iPhone 3g are expected (i.e. 499 lower memory unit,599 higher capacity ones).
